

Our Beloved Tony Almanza was born in Austin, Texas in 1966 and departed this earth unexpectedly on Thursday, September 5, 2024. In Tony’s early years, he grew up in East Austin with his siblings He enjoyed playing the saxophone in the band, and attending boxing classes at Martin Jr. High. Tony pursued mechanics and was truly the “Jack of all Trades.” Tony took on a career with his special craftsmen skills in mechanics, and enjoyed his social life of dancing and hanging out with his friends & family while rooting for the Dallas Cowboys. Tony will be missed tremendously and will always be remembered for his contagious smile and the way that he always radiated positivity through life’s toughest trials.
